wps vba宏代码大全
时间: 2025-01-08 22:49:47 浏览: 7
### WPS VBA 宏代码 示例
对于希望深入了解并应用WPS中的VBA宏功能的用户来说,掌握一些基础示例有助于快速上手。下面提供了一个简单的例子来展示如何通过VBA实现自动保存当前文档到指定路径的功能。
#### 自动保存文档至特定文件夹
```vba
Sub AutoSaveDocument()
Dim filePath As String
' 设置要保存的目标位置
filePath = "C:\Users\YourName\Desktop\" & ActiveDocument.Name
' 执行保存动作
ActiveDocument.SaveAs2 fileName:=filePath, FileFormat:=wdFormatXMLDocument
End Sub
```
这段代码定义了一个名为`AutoSaveDocument`的过程,在运行时会获取活动文档的名字,并将其连同设定好的目录一起作为参数传递给`SaveAs2`方法完成另存新副本的动作[^1]。
---
为了帮助开发者更好地理解和编写适用于WPS Office环境下的VBA脚本,官方及相关社区提供了丰富的学习资料和技术支持渠道:
- **官方文档与教程**:访问[WPS官方网站](https://www.wps.cn/)可以找到关于集成VBA特性的详细介绍以及入门指南。
- **开源项目实例**:如提到的一个具体版本号为7.0.1590的WPS VBA插件,其源码托管于GitCode平台上的仓库内,可供研究者查阅和借鉴其中的应用场景及编码技巧。
- **转换工具与案例分享**:考虑到部分原有基于Microsoft Word编写的VBA逻辑可能需要迁移到WPS平台上执行的情况,有专门针对此类需求推出的解决方案——即将原有的VBA语法结构映射成适合JavaScript解释器解析的形式,从而实现在不同软件间平滑过渡的目的[^2]。
阅读全文